Compounding Manager – Old Toongabbie
 

Full-Time | Permanent

Are you a dynamic leader with a passion for driving operational excellence?

We have a rare and exciting opportunity to join our Compounding Operations as the Compounding Manager, overseeing our Old Toongabbie site.

In this pivotal role you will lead and inspire a large team, fostering a culture of accountability and collaboration and ensure smooth production operations while maintaining the highest standards of product quality and compliance.

In this role you will build and manage strong relationships with internal and external stakeholders along with driving continuous improvement initiatives, problem-solve effectively, and implement process refinements to support business growth.

Key Responsibilities:

  • People leadership across the facility

  • Providing leadership development, coaching and motivation to all team members

  • Strategic workforce planning, including resourcing

  • Oversight of training and development plans for all team members

  • Oversight of implementation of EHS policies and procedures

  • Budget management

  • Driving Process and productivity improvement at the site

  • Ensure quality standards and procedures are being maintained

  • Oversight of Quality incidents and investigations

  • Management of customer relationships

  • Point of escalation for all matters pertaining to the site


 

Key Requirements of the role include:

  • Pharmacy Degree, Science Degree or approved equivalent qualification

  • Lean Manufacturing

  • Leadership and Management skills

  • Production/Operations/Manufacturing experience

  • Problem Solving Skills

  • Sound business acumen

  • Sound decision making skills

  • Excellent communication skills

  • Ability to build and maintain effective relationships with internal/external customers

  • Negotiation skills

Desirable Skills and Qualifications

  • Experience in aseptic compounding

  • Knowledge of the Code of Good Manufacturing Practice

  • Kiezen/Automation
